Transaction 03c3cfc96415b158a3f791bd61f8f9d69673866636bf9b1eb490502592844f75

1 Input
2 Outputs
  • 03c3cfc96415b158a3f791bd61f8f9d69673866636bf9b1eb490502592844f75:0
  • value  250000
    address  1D7FKyoDQspbucdLamUQMgPrLHNobdUj5e
  • 03c3cfc96415b158a3f791bd61f8f9d69673866636bf9b1eb490502592844f75:1
  • value  49713578
    address  3Czxhoh4sifkc4QJrh7W3anuSCoKLwEpTm